Pembuatan Biodiesel Berbahan Baku CPO Menggunakan Reaktor Sentrifugal dengan Variasi Rasio Umpan dan Komposisi Katalis

Abstract


One  of many  sources  of  alternative  fuel  is  biodiesel  . Biodiesel  production  cost  is  still
quite  expensive,  it  need  a  technology  to  reduce  thecost  of  biodiesel  production  .  Centrifugal
reactor  technology  is  one  of  the  alternative  technology  of  biodiesel  production, which  is  very
likely to be developed .Study of biodiesel production using palm oil as the feedstock, methanol as
the  reagent, and NaOH as catalyst.This  research use centrifugal  reactor as  the  reactor, which
has  a  pre-heater  for  feed,  feed  tank  and  pumps.  The  study  was  conducted  at  the  reaction
temperature of 60ºC with a residence time in the reactor for 2 hours . CPO mixture , methanol ,
and a catalyst in the feed the reactor with variation in the molar methanol : CPO ( 3:1 , 6:1 , 9:1
, 12:1  ) and  the variation of  the  composition of  the catalyst  ( 0.5, 0.75, 1 %  - w  )  . From  the
results of the study showed that the molar ratio and catalyst composition affects the speed of the
reaction  to reach equilibrium reaction  . The results showed biodiesel using centrifugal reactor
reaches  a  yield  of  92.6 %  under  the  conditions  of  9:1  molar  ratio  with  0.75 %-w  catalyst  .
Characteristics of biodiesel produced in the form of viscosity , density , acid number , and flash
point of biodiesel are qualified as Indonesian standards of Biodiesel.
